Staff Applications
Each year the Northeast Greek Leadership Association extends an invitation to both undergraduate and graduate students
to apply for a position as a member of the Conference Staff. This is an excellent opportunity for those that have interests in
continued involvement in the fraternity and sorority community, a career in higher education or fraternity and sorority affairs,
event planning, or would like to attend the conference but lack the resources. It has been an enjoyable and enriching
experience for those that have previously served on Conference Staff, as you can read for yourself.
